Big Island Neighborhood Gems

The Big Island boasts diverse communities, each with its own unique charm. Here are a few neighborhoods that offer excellent value for money when it comes to homes with guest cottages:

  • South Kona: Known for its volcanic landscapes, black sand beaches, and world-class coffee plantations, South Kona offers stunning vistas and a laid-back lifestyle. Explore charming towns like Holualoa and Captain Cook, enjoying local art galleries and farm-to-table dining.
  • Hilo: The largest city on the Big Island, Hilo is a cultural hub with access to lush rainforests, waterfalls, and the Pacific ocean. Enjoy a vibrant arts scene, local festivals, and proximity to Hilo’s farmers market.
  • Keauhou: A beautiful coastal area on the Kona side, Keauhou is perfect for water enthusiasts. The Keauhou Shopping Center offers a variety of shops and restaurants, and the Keauhou Bay offers fantastic snorkeling and diving opportunities.

Table 1

Neighborhood Average Home Price Pros Cons
South Kona $650,000-$750,000 Stunning views, coffee plantations, quiet beaches More remote location, limited nightlife
Hilo $450,000 – $600,000 Vibrant cultural scene, easy access to rainforests, more affordable Can be more humid, occasional rain showers
Keauhou $550,000 – $700,000 Beautiful beaches, snorkeling and diving, close to amenities Touristy areas, more expensive than Hilo

FAQs: Big Island Guest Cottage Homes Under $800k

  • Q: What are guest cottages on Big Island properties?

    A: Guest cottages are separate, self-contained units on a larger property. They often have their own kitchen, bathroom, and living area, making them ideal for renting out or hosting family and friends.

  • Q: Are guest cottages worth it on the Big Island?

    A: Guest cottages can be a great investment, generating rental income and providing additional living space.

  • Q: Can I find Big Island guest cottage homes under $800k?

    A: Yes, there are opportunities to find guest cottage homes on the Big Island for under $800k, although inventory can fluctuate.

  • Q: What should I consider when buying a guest cottage home?

    A:

    • Location: Consider proximity to beaches, amenities, and attractions.
    • Size and layout: Determine the ideal size of the main home and the guest cottage.
    • Condition: Assess the condition of both structures and consider potential renovation costs.
    • Zoning regulations: Check local zoning laws regarding guest cottage permits and rentals.
    • Rental potential: Research local rental rates and demand for guest cottages.
